The first step in noisy garage door repair is to identify the source of the noise. Common culprits embody worn-out rollers, free hinges, or lack of lubrication. Each of these points contributes differently to the general sound produced by the door, and understanding the cause may help determine the simplest repair.
One main issue is the garage door’s rollers. These parts assist facilitate the graceful opening and shutting of the door. If they become worn, rusty, or misaligned, they might create a loud grating or grinding noise. Checking the rollers for harm is crucial. Replacing them often resolves a lot of the noise.

Another potential supply of noise might be the hinges. Over time, hinges can become loose or rusty. If they are not functioning easily, you may hear loud clanking or banging sounds because the door moves. Lubricating hinges often might help keep their function and scale back noise.
Proper lubrication is crucial throughout the entire garage door system. Not solely should the rollers and hinges be lubricated, but also the track alongside which the door runs. A lack of lubrication may end up in a creaky sound, which might turn out to be increasingly bothersome over time.
You may find that the door’s spring system plays a role in its noisiness. Springs tensioned incorrectly can create loud popping or snapping noises when the door is used. It’s critical to be cautious with spring changes, as they're underneath significant rigidity and may be hazardous if not handled correctly.

Sometimes, the noise may result from unfastened hardware, like bolts and screws. Regularly tightening these components can usually alleviate excessive sounds. It’s advisable to routinely inspect all hardware and tighten something that seems out of place.

- Inspect the rollers and hinges for wear and tear, as damaged elements usually contribute to loud noises throughout operation.
- Lubricate all shifting components, including springs, tracks, and hinges, to reduce friction and decrease noise levels.
- Check the alignment of the tracks; misaligned tracks can cause rattling and extra stress on the door.
- Tighten unfastened screws and bolts, as vibrations may cause elements to loosen over time, leading to added noise.
- Evaluate the motor for wear; a failing motor can produce grinding or whining sounds that point out it’s time for repair or alternative.
- Install weather stripping to dampen sounds and improve insulation towards outdoors noise.
- Consider including soundproofing supplies within the garage to soak up vibrations and cut back the noise of a functioning door.
- Regular maintenance checks may help you establish issues before they escalate, ensuring a quieter operation.
- Look into upgrading to a quieter garage door opener, especially those designed with noise-reduction features.

What type of lubricant ought to I use for my garage door?
Using a silicone-based or lithium grease lubricant is recommended for garage door elements. Avoid utilizing heavy oils, as they will attract filth and debris, leading to additional issues.
